#7388c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7388c0 is composed of 45.1% red, 53.3%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.1% cyan, 29.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 223.6 degrees, a saturation of 37.9% and a lightness of 60.2%. #7388c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ffff with #001181.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

● #7388c0 color description : Slightly desaturated blue.
#7388c0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7388c0 has RGB values of R:115, G:136,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 7571648.

Shades and Tints of #7388c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040509 is the darkest color, while #fafb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7388c0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9296a1 is the less saturated color, while #356cfe is the most saturated one.
